Solar thermal power plants – whether parabolic trough or solar tower – are mostly constructed in desert areas with plenty of sun. In such places, soiling from sand and dust causes high uncertainties in the yield forecast and increased operating costs. In the “AVUSpro” project, the Fraunhofer Institute for Solar Energy Systems ISE, PSE Instruments GmbH, TSK Flagsol Engineering GmbH and Dornier Suntrace GmbH have developed a fully automatic device to measure soiling. The four partners have successfully tested the measurement device in a solar parabolic trough power plant in Kuwait. The collected data can be used to optimize cleaning techniques and cycles to increase yield and minimize costs and water use.

Advanced zinc battery developer Enzinc has closed a $4.5 million seed round led by Portland-based 3×5 Partners. Enzinc is developing high-powered zinc batteries for mobility and stationary uses. Batteries manufactured by today’s leading lead acid brands with the ‘Enzinc Inside’ drop-in technology will have the power of lithium at the cost of lead acid, with no fire potential or HVAC requirement and a wide temperature operating range.
